WebDec 12, 2024 · Tags ending in -alpha, -beta, and -rc, followed by a number, are pre-releases. Read more about the distinctions between Alpha, Beta and RC. Tags which end in a number, without the -…N suffix, are stable releases. All pre-release tags must end with a number. The first is numbered 1 (as in …-alpha1), the next 2 (as in …-alpha2), and so on. The software release life cycle is the process of developing, testing, and distributing a software product. It typically consists of several stages, such as pre-alpha, alpha, beta, and release candidate, before the final version, or "gold," is released to the public. Pre-alpha refers to the early stages of development, when … See more Pre-alpha Pre-alpha refers to all activities performed during the software project before formal testing.
